When to Consider Upgrading Your VPS Resources

Before upgrading, it's important to identify whether your VPS actually needs more resources. Here are common signs that indicate it's time to upgrade:

  • Your server frequently runs out of available RAM, causing slow performance or process crashes
  • CPU usage consistently exceeds 80-90% during normal operations
  • Your website or application experiences slow load times even after optimization
  • You're receiving low memory warnings or notices from your monitoring tools
  • Your business is growing and you anticipate increased traffic or resource demands

Understanding Resource Allocation

When you upgrade your VPS, the new RAM and CPU resources become immediately available to your server. However, keep these points in mind:

  • RAM: Additional memory is allocated instantly and can be used by your applications without any configuration changes
  • CPU: Extra CPU cores are available immediately, but some applications may need to be restarted to take full advantage of the additional processing power
  • No reinstallation required: Your data, configurations, and installed applications remain unchanged during the upgrade
  • Minimal downtime: Most upgrades complete without requiring a reboot, though a brief restart may be needed in some cases

Cost Considerations and Billing

Understanding how upgrades affect your billing helps you plan your budget effectively:

  • Upgrades are typically prorated, meaning you only pay for the difference between your old and new plan for the remainder of your billing cycle
  • Future renewal dates will reflect the new pricing for your upgraded plan
  • You can downgrade later if needed, though some providers have restrictions on downgrade frequency
  • Consider upgrading before peak traffic periods to ensure optimal performance when you need it most

Monitoring Your VPS After Upgrading

After upgrading your resources, monitor your VPS performance to ensure the upgrade meets your needs:

  • Check CPU and RAM usage through your VPS control panel or monitoring tools
  • Verify that your applications are running smoothly and load times have improved
  • Monitor for any error messages or warnings that might indicate configuration issues
  • Track your website or application performance metrics over the next few days

If you find that your resource usage is still too high after upgrading, you may need to optimize your applications or consider a larger plan.
